– Tips for buying quality chicken

barbecue

When it comes to a delicious BBQ baked chicken recipe, the foundation lies in the quality of your ingredients, especially the chicken. Look for whole, fresh chickens that are free-range and organic whenever possible. The flesh should be plump, smooth, and unmarbled, indicating proper care and nutrition during raising. Avoid birds with overly shiny or thin skin; instead, opt for a more natural, slightly rougher appearance, which often means better flavor and texture.

Consider buying from local butchers or farmers’ markets where you can inspect the chickens yourself. This ensures you get the freshest product, free of preservatives and unnecessary additives. If you’re buying pre-cut chicken parts, check labels carefully; look for options with minimal processing to maintain superior taste and quality. Marinating the Chicken for Maximum Flavor

barbecue

Marinating the chicken is a game-changer for any BBQ baked chicken recipe. It’s a simple yet effective way to infuse maximum flavor into your meal. By soaking the chicken in a mixture of oils, acids, spices, and herbs before cooking, you create a complex taste profile that permeates every bite. This process also helps to tenderize the meat, making it juicy and delicious.

For our family-friendly BBQ chicken recipe, we recommend marinating the chicken for at least 2 hours, but overnight is even better. Use a mixture of olive oil, vinegar, garlic, herbs like thyme and rosemary, and a pinch of salt and pepper. This combination not only enhances the natural flavors of the chicken but also helps to create a beautiful crispy skin when baked, satisfying both picky eaters and food enthusiasts alike.
